Price

Mobility scooters can be a lifesaver to those who suffer from restricted mobility due to a medical condition, accident or simply the passage of time. These unique scooters can provide an entirely new level of freedom and independence for those who use them and can help alleviate the pain that is caused by conditions such as Rheumatoid arthritis. Mobility scooters can be expensive and you must do some research before buying one. Fortunately, there are things you can do to make the cost of mobility scooters more manageable.

One way to reduce the cost of a mobility scooter is to shop around for the most affordable price. Many stores offer free shipping and a broad selection of options. This could save you a significant amount of money, particularly when you purchase multiple scooters.

Another method of reducing the cost of a mobility scooter is to avail insurance coverage or financing options. These programs can help lower the initial cost of purchase and some even permit you to rent your mobility scooter for a monthly fee. This is an ideal option for those who want to make use of their mobility scooters frequently, but may not be financially able to pay for the entire cost up front.

The type of scooter you select will also impact the price. For instance, portable lightweight scooters usually cost less than regular models. They are able to be removed to fit into a vehicle or trunk. They also have a smaller capacity for weight and a smaller operating range than the standard models.

On the other hand, a class 3 mobility scooter is able to be used on public roads, and can hold more cargo. The class 3 model is more than one of class 2 models, but could be worth it for certain users.

Other elements that can affect the price of a mobility vehicle include its dimensions, weight-bearing capacity and the available accessories. Choosing a scooter with ample storage space can help you avoid having to carry large bags on your back, which can be a challenge for those who struggles with mobility issues.

The Right to Rent

It is crucial to research the warranty offered by a manufacturer before purchasing a mobility scooter. The scooter should come with a limited warranty that covers the parts and labor for a certain amount of time. The warranty should cover the cost of repairs in the event of malfunctions, or accidents. The majority of scooters are covered by an unrestricted parts-and-labor warranty for a period of one year after the date of purchase. Some companies offer an extended warranty for added security.

Consider the maintenance history of the scooter before you purchase one. If you're buying a secondhand one, look for documents that reveal how frequently the machine was serviced. Check that the tires are in good condition. If the tires are worn this means that the scooter has been sitting for a long time.

Examine the battery condition. This is usually mentioned in the manual. If it is low, you may want to replace it. Beware of used scooters advertised as brand new. These models are typically sold at a lower price than their original retail price and don't often come with warranties.

Before you buy a scooter, consider the place and how you'll use it. If you'll be frequenting the mall a lot, for example, then an easy-to-use, lightweight scooter might work best place to buy a mobility scooter for you. If you'll be traveling on paths and sidewalks and trails, then a bigger heavy-duty scooter could be the best choice.

It's also important to find out if your insurance will cover your scooter. Medicare, for instance, covers scooters and other mobility aids under Part B of its Durable Medical Equipment (DME) benefit. Contact your doctor to discuss the condition you suffer from and determine if you are eligible.
